Executive District Manager Salaries in the United States

How much does a Executive District Manager make in the United States?

Executive District Managers earn $75,000 annually on average, or $36 per hour, which is 13% more than the national average for all working Americans. Our data indicates that the best paid Executive District Managers work for Johnson & Johnson at $130,000 annually while the lowest paid Executive District Managers work for Arbonne International earning approximately $37,000 each year.
